A missing repo man's remains are found inside a septic tank, and the Jeffersonian is introduced to new Cuban intern Rodolfo Fuentes (Ignacio Serricchio), who attempts to charm the ladies, much to Booth's ire.

  • As You Know: Hodgins explains Fuentes's own culture to him about ropa vieja.
  • Latin Lover: Fuentes hits on all the women in the lab aggressively. Angela appreciates how hot he is.
